Is … WebAug 18, 2024 · This 21st century industrial revolution, termed Pharma 4.0 by the ISPE, is being catalyzed by the adoption of networked systems, data analytics & advanced automation. Together, these innovations are pushing the limits of efficiency, agility and quality across the pharmaceutical supply chain.

The term Pharma 4.0, like its generalized cousin Industry 4.0, reflects the transformative impact of automation and digitalization on manufacturing.
